The following information is to be gained from a typical broadband decoupled 13 C-NMR spectrum: How many types of C ? Indicated by how many signals there are in the spectra. What types of C ? Indicated by the chemical shift of each signal. Here are some examples of 13 C-NMR spectra.

Web30 jan. 2024 · Nuclear Magnetic Resonance – NMR Spectroscopy. The nuclei of certain elements, including 1 H nuclei (protons) and 13 C (carbon-13) nuclei, behave as though they were magnets spinning about an axis.
